annotate dsp/maths/Correlation.h @ 3:07ac3de1e53b

* Give the chromagram an alternative entry point passing in frequency domain data * Centre the Hamming windows and do an fftshift when calculating sparse kernel
author cannam
date Mon, 15 May 2006 15:07:27 +0000
parents d7116e3183f8
children
rev   line source
cannam@0 1 /* -*- c-basic-offset: 4 indent-tabs-mode: nil -*- vi:set ts=8 sts=4 sw=4: */
cannam@0 2
cannam@0 3 /*
cannam@0 4 QM DSP Library
cannam@0 5
cannam@0 6 Centre for Digital Music, Queen Mary, University of London.
cannam@0 7 This file copyright 2005-2006 Christian Landone.
cannam@0 8 All rights reserved.
cannam@0 9 */
cannam@0 10
cannam@0 11 #ifndef CORRELATION_H
cannam@0 12 #define CORRELATION_H
cannam@0 13
cannam@0 14 #define EPS 2.2204e-016
cannam@0 15
cannam@0 16 class Correlation
cannam@0 17 {
cannam@0 18 public:
cannam@0 19 void doAutoUnBiased( double* src, double* dst, unsigned int length );
cannam@0 20 Correlation();
cannam@0 21 virtual ~Correlation();
cannam@0 22
cannam@0 23 };
cannam@0 24
cannam@0 25 #endif //